龙空技术网

css如何引入特殊字体

Dhail 102

前言:

今天各位老铁们对“css字体转换”大致比较讲究,兄弟们都想要分析一些“css字体转换”的相关知识。那么小编在网摘上网罗了一些对于“css字体转换””的相关知识,希望各位老铁们能喜欢,咱们一起来了解一下吧!

在前端开发过程中难免会用到特殊字体,如何引入特殊字体?

首先你得有字体文件,文件格式为,TTF、OTF、EOT、SVG将字体文件放入本地文件夹中或者服务器上css中引入,以下为引入方法

@font-face {  font-family: 'icomoon'; // 这里自定义字体名称   src:  url('fonts/icomoon.eot?'); // 文件路径或者服务器路径  src:  url('fonts/icomoon.eot?') format('embedded-opentype'), // format属性:字体的格式 主要用于浏览器识别    url('fonts/icomoon.ttf?') format('truetype'),    url('fonts/icomoon.woff?') format('woff'),    url('fonts/icomoon.svg?') format('svg');  font-weight: normal;  font-style: normal;  font-display: block;}/* 调用 */body{    font-family:'icomoon'}

注:eot为IE专用,ttf官方说是苹果和微软为PostScript 而开发的字体格式,个人理解为通用格式。woff是压缩过后轻量级,svg对文本支持不太好

标签: #css字体转换